Philadelphia is a diverse city rich in culture and art, a perfect spot to embark on an educational journey.

Where to even start? Philadelphia is packed with American history around every corner, whether it be the Liberty Bell, the Betsy Ross House, or the African American Museum. These glimpses into our history are priceless moments that aren’t available in every city and certainly not to the extent that they are in Philadelphia. This city is also home to several museums, ranging from antique medicine at the Mutter to the renowned Museum of Art, as well as our famous, decorative street murals. Rather than being assigned to research a painter online, students can venture out into the city and see the artwork in person. Encouraging a child to go outside and learn through experience is much more worthwhile than sitting them in front of a computer with a research topic.

Philly is famous for more than its history and culture- the food deserves a spotlight of its own. The wide selection of restaurants and markets that set up shop in Philadelphia are an opportunity for students to go outside their comfort zone in terms of cuisine. Rather than the bland burgers and milk on a lunch tray, students can try foods they’ve never been exposed to before, harboring new tastes for the rest of their lives. The culture of a city is heavily reflected in the food people eat there, and Philly is no stranger to unique and authentic flavors, both in in culture and cuisine.
